Application
This unit describes the skills required to identify wastewater microorganisms and select appropriate measures to optimise the growth of beneficial microorganisms.
This unit applies to those working as wastewater treatment operational specialists.
The skills and knowledge described in this unit must be applied within the legislative, regulatory and policy environment in which they are carried out. Organisational policies and procedures must be consulted and adhered to.
Those undertaking this unit would work autonomously, performing sophisticated tasks in a familiar context.

Elements and Performance Criteria
ELEMENTS |
PERFORMANCE CRITERIA |
Elements describe the essential outcomes |
Performance criteria describe the performance needed to demonstrate achievement of the element. Where bold italicised text is used, further information is detailed in the range of conditions section. |
1. Investigate wastewater microorganisms |
1.1 Identify a range of typical wastewater microorganisms. 1.2 Identify the general characteristics of different types of microorganisms. 1.3 Identify wastewater characteristics that impact on microorganism growth. 1.4 Identify the problems caused by microorganisms in specific wastewater treatment processes. |
2. Select strategies to optimise the growth of beneficial microorganisms |
2.1 Investigate the cause of effluent quality issues. 2.2 Investigate the operational status of the wastewater treatment process. 2.3 Assess the effectiveness of various process control strategies to optimise the growth of beneficial microorganisms. 2.4 Select the most appropriate method. |
3. Identify and report on appropriate process controls |
3.1 Identify treatment process conditions for optimising the growth of beneficial microorganisms. 3.2 Report on appropriate treatment processes and associated sampling and testing requirements. |
